How they compare

Saint Vincent and the Grenadines currently reports 94.6% against 86.2% in WB: Latin America & Caribbean (excluding High Income), a difference of 8.4%.

That makes Saint Vincent and the Grenadines's figure about 1.1 times WB: Latin America & Caribbean (excluding High Income)'s.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2010 it was WB: Latin America & Caribbean (excluding High Income) ahead.

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 78th and WB: Latin America & Caribbean (excluding High Income) ranks 81st of 180 countries.

Saint Vincent and the Grenadines has averaged higher in every one of the 1 decades both report.
